Output 31e686f497b68890d62b21fbca5c25b4031b0eec69fb66d71aa4a2f76fb0945f:1

value
29983388
script pubkey
OP_0 OP_PUSHBYTES_20 6fa0c888d8181ea6f101f57b8eb5c334bb42b1a0
address
bc1qd7sv3zxcrq02dugp74acadwrxja59vdqg2v6d5
transaction
31e686f497b68890d62b21fbca5c25b4031b0eec69fb66d71aa4a2f76fb0945f